A women’s strawweight division affair is the latest addition to UFC Fight Night Norfolk as Angela Hill is going to be in action against Nina Ansaroff.

Hill (7-3-0) has won just one of two in her second UFC run, defeating Ashley Yoder and suffering a defeat to Jessica Andrade. Hill is a former Invicta Fighting Championships Strawweight Champion, defeating Livia Renata Souza at Invicta FC 17 to win the belt. Hill also competed on the UFC Ultimate Fighter 20, losing in the opening round of the reality show to Carla Esparza.

Ansaroff (7-5-0) has won just one of three fights under the UFC banner, with that lone win coming over the now retired Jocelyn Jones-Lybarger at UFC Fight Night 103. Ansaroff also competed once in the Invicta Fighting Championships, defeating Munah Holland at Invicta FC 7. Ansaroff has only won just one fight in the last four years, which was the aforementioned win over Jones-Lybarger earlier this year.

UFC Fight Night Norfolk takes place on Saturday, November 11 from the Ted Constant Convocation Center in Norfolk, Virginia with Dustin Poirier and Anthony Pettis headlining. Fightful is providing live coverage of the event, which airs live on Fox Sports 1.
